GISBORNE.
June 22nd. At Golf. At the Poverty Bay golf links last Saturday afternoon a men's handicap tournament took place. A large number of ladies arrived for afternoon tea. the links being practically devoted to the men on Saturdays. Mesdames. A. Jj. ■Muir and J. W. J. Preston and Miss Taylor provided a delicious tea.
